C h a p t e r 3 | E l e c t r i f i c a t i o n a n d t h e Fu t u r e o f Av i a t i o n Key Points • The shift toward greater electrification in aviation aims to eliminate fossil fuel reliance by embracing electric propulsion. • The major engineering challenge in electric aviation is managing the increased aircraft weight caused by batteries, electric motors, and cabling, all of which affect flight efficiency. • Electrification demands extensive new infrastructure, such as high-capacity airport charging stations, which require significant investment and grid upgrades to support sustainable power needs. • Analog Devices is advancing electric aviation by developing power management semiconductor solutions and sensors to optimize electric propulsion systems and digitize aviation. • Amphenol contributes to electric aviation by creating high-performance connectivity solutions and using advanced materials to enhance the reliability and manage the weight of electric aircraft systems.
